WP1 Pedagogical framework
Project months: 1 – 36; Lead beneficiary: UT
The main objective of this work package is to specify the Go-Lab learning spaces (the online labs and learning environment as students will experience them) and a set of classroom inquiry scenarios that provide teachers with guidelines on how to use Go-Lab in the broader classroom setting including collaboration between students. The Go-Lab learning spaces include, next to the online labs, an inquiry processes structure, a selection and specification of cognitive scaffolds for each inquiry process, and a common Go-Lab experimentation interface that centers on the inquiry process structure. The overview of processes and scaffolds is domain and student level dependent. Scaffolds can be defined online as a part of the Go-Lab learning space or off-line as a teacher or peer activity. The use of Go-Lab learning spaces in the classroom is described in a set of concrete inquiry classroom scenarios. A curriculum analysis is performed in different countries to ensure that from the content and pedagogical approach point of view the Go-Lab approaches and solutions can be seamlessly integrated into the curriculum.
